Personal Advisors, Care Leavers Service
We are further expanding our service and are recruiting Personal Advisors who will be supporting our care experienced young people as they transition into adulthood. We are looking for applicants who share our passion for delivering the very best support to our care experienced young people in meet their aspirations and realising their full potential.
In this role you will:
Support young people to develop their independent living skills and to be successfully engaged in education, training and employment. Undertake regular visits and work collaboratively with young people and those supporting them within the framework of their pathway plan. Provide young person-focused support to ensure our care leavers achieve their ambitions and realise their highest potential. Work as part of a supportive team to provide a high quality service to all of our young people Our Care Leavers Service is one of the nation’s biggest and supports care experienced young adults in their transition from care to independence.
Our priority is to support and enable our care experienced young adults to realise their aspiration and ambition and have a sense of feeling cared for, cared about, and able to care for themselves. Championing their voice as corporate parents is central to all that we do and achieve with them.
